첨부한 사진 처럼 성적필드 업데이트 란에 [성적]+2를 입력하면
[성적]+"2"로 자동으로 바뀌어서 입력이 됩니다.
채점프로그램으로 채점을 하면
점수변경 쿼리('UPDATE 성적 SET 성적.성적 = [성적]+"2" WHERE ( ( ( 성적.시험날짜 ) Between #12/8/2013# And #12/10/2013# ) ) ; ')가 정답('UPDATE 성적 SET 성적.성적 = [성적]+2 WHERE ( ( ( 성적.시험날짜 ) Between #12/8/2013# And #12/10/2013# ) ) ; ')과 다릅니다.
라고 나오면서 틀렸다고 나옵니다.
이와 같은 질문에 ([성적]+2) 이렇게 입력하라고 답변해주셨는데
([성적]+2)로 입력하면 채점프로그램에서는
점수변경 쿼리('UPDATE 성적 SET 성적.성적 = ( [성적]+2 ) WHERE ( ( ( 성적.시험날짜 ) Between #12/8/2013# And #12/10/2013# ) ) ; ')가 정답('UPDATE 성적 SET 성적.성적 = [성적]+2 WHERE ( ( ( 성적.시험날짜 ) Between #12/8/2013# And #12/10/2013# ) ) ; ')과 다릅니다.
이렇게 나오면서 틀렸다고만 나옵니다.
답안에 나온데로 그대로 풀었는데도 자꾸 이렇게 나옵니다.
해결방법없나요?
두번째 식으로 작성한 경우 정확한 결과가 나오지 않나요?
실제 시험에서는 정확한 결과가 나오면 정답으로 인정 됩니다.
혹시 성적 필드의 데이터 형식이 숫자가 아닌것은 아닌지 확인 해 보세요.
데이터 형식이 숫자가 아닌 경우 문자로 표시되는 경우가 있습니다.
좋은 하루 되세요.
-
*2015-09-01 15:30:43
두번째 식으로 작성한 경우 정확한 결과가 나오지 않나요?
실제 시험에서는 정확한 결과가 나오면 정답으로 인정 됩니다.
혹시 성적 필드의 데이터 형식이 숫자가 아닌것은 아닌지 확인 해 보세요.
데이터 형식이 숫자가 아닌 경우 문자로 표시되는 경우가 있습니다.
좋은 하루 되세요.